First Trust Indxx Innovative Transaction & Process ETF
ETF Overview
Overview
The First Trust Indxx Innovative Transaction & Process ETF (FTXO) seeks investment results that correspond generally to the price and yield, before fees and expenses, of the Indxx Innovative Transaction & Process Index. This index is designed to track companies that are significantly transforming transaction and payment processes, impacting the financial sector and consumer behavior.
Reputation and Reliability
First Trust is a well-established ETF provider with a strong reputation for offering innovative and thematic investment products.
Management Expertise
First Trust Advisors L.P. has extensive experience in managing ETFs and a dedicated team focused on thematic investing.
Investment Objective
Goal
To track the investment results, before fees and expenses, of the Indxx Innovative Transaction & Process Index.
Investment Approach and Strategy
Strategy: The ETF tracks a specific index, the Indxx Innovative Transaction & Process Index, which focuses on companies involved in innovative transaction and payment processes.
Composition The ETF holds stocks of companies that are involved in areas such as mobile payments, blockchain, digital wallets, and other transaction-related technologies.

Competitors
Key Competitors
- ARK Fintech Innovation ETF (ARKF)
- Global X FinTech ETF (FINX)
- ETFMG Prime Mobile Payments ETF (IPAY)
Competitive Landscape
The ETF industry in the fintech and payment processing sector is competitive. FTXO competes with other ETFs that also target innovative transaction and payment companies. FTXO's focus on a specific index differentiates it, but its success depends on the index's performance and how it compares to similar indexes tracked by competitors. Smaller AUM may impact liquidity compared to larger competitors. ARKF and FINX have significantly larger AUM and trading volume.

About First Trust Indxx Innovative Transaction & Process ETF

The fund will normally invest at least 90% of its net assets (including investment borrowings) in common stocks and depositary receipts that comprise the index. The index is designed to track the performance of companies that are either actively using, investing in, developing, or have products that are poised to benefit from blockchain technology and/or the potential for increased efficiency that it provides to various business processes.
